This keeps builds reproducible and lets the licensing review team audit exactly what we distribute. When adding a font, record its license file alongside the binaries, run the subsetting script to strip unused glyph ranges, and update the attribution manifest. Never vendor a font without a completed license review, even for prototypes. The full vendoring checklist and license review workflow are documented on the internal page below.

wiki page, bajog-tahop: https://confluence.qorvelsys.internal/browse/pages/pages/pages

**14:22** — Confirmed the Hallowmere partner SFTP drop had stopped ingesting at 13:05. Uploads were landing but the Ferryline poller crashed on a zero-byte manifest. Restarted the poller with manifest validation skipped; backlog of 41 files cleared by 14:40. Patch to handle empty manifests merged same day. The poller build running at incident time is noted below.

pipeline stamp: htk21_104c5ba7d0df6b2897cd5

Handover: the Fernwick digest scheduler now batches weekly emails at 06:00 UTC instead of hourly. Cron config lives in the digest-sched repo; the retry window was widened to 30 minutes after last week's queue stall. No open incidents. For the 4.2 release, no migration steps are needed. Questions about scheduling behavior should go to the new owner, named below.

named custodian: Brivan Eliath Quenox Frador